+Omegamatrix #455 Posted July 5, 2012 I found the erased space in this rom along time ago, but the Home Vision rom is more than just the logo restored. If you look at the hmove comb to the left you will see the gaps are different in the Treasure Discovery rom when compared to the Suntek version. This is likely caused by some stuff being shifted around in the rom, or added/deleted WSYNC's. Quote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

Rom Hunter #459 Posted July 7, 2012 (edited) I don't think there truly exists a game called Zoo Fun released by Home Vision. It has never been confirmed to exist, therefore I will remove this title from our database. The only reason it was listed in our database, is that it was mentioned in a very old VCS games list once. IMO Home Vision released Panda Chase and then ITT Family Games ripped it off to 'release' Pumuckl I, followed by Suntek's Zoo Fun. Ski Run is definitely a Home Vision original (the Suntek artwork looks like it has been redrawn from a Home Vision label and there's a Home Vision vaporware title called Skiing Game), but since this cart has not been found yet, I consider the Suntek version as the original for now.
